Responsibilities

• Receive, maintain, and process student submissions of Department of Defense tuition assistance (TA) via ArmyIgnitED and the Air Force Virtual Education Center. Analyze registrations in PeopleSoft to determine if they accurately match tuition assistance submissions.

• Assess student financials through accounting functions in PeopleSoft and determine what charges are eligible for Department of Defense funding.

• Resolve student financial records by placing applicable charges into contract for Department of Defense invoicing via PeopleSoft accounting functions.

• Monitor student activity throughout the semester, troubleshoot and adjust tuition assistance records in ArmyIgnitED and the Air Force Virtual Education Center accordingly based on Department of Defense memorandum of understanding requirements to ensure institutional compliance.

• Work with students to manage their accounts through various military portals. Reconcile student activity between PeopleSoft and various portals in a timely fashion to ensure appropriate processing of benefits and institutional compliance.

• Involves reporting of grades, uploading of degree plans, keeping institutional data up to date, submitting help desk tickets and regular trouble shooting of behalf of our students.

• Understand the complexities of VA regulations and be able to provide detailed yet understandable explanations to students and staff.

• Advise students and other University departments on campus of specific University policies and procedures related to registration and payment at University College to assist students in making informed decisions and avoid future issues.

• Direct new and current students through the University College Online Registration process for credit and non-credit students.

• Troubleshoot and solve registration issues that result in student ineligibility to register due to course restrictions and holds.

Commitment to Supporting and Hiring Veterans

Syracuse University has a long history of engaging veterans and the military-connected community through its educational programs, community outreach, and employment programs. After World War II, Syracuse University welcomed more than 10,000 returning veterans to our campus, and those veterans literally transformed Syracuse University into the national research institution it is today. The University’s contemporary commitment to veterans builds on this historical legacy, and extends to both class-leading initiatives focused on making an SU degree accessible and affordable to the post-9/11 generation of veterans, and also programs designed to position Syracuse University as the employer of choice for military veterans, members of the Guard and Reserve, and military family members.
